What is the approximate ratio of rural outlets to urban outlets?

According to statistic, there is around 17,000 Urban outlets for Every 5,000 Rural outlets.

Based on this , the approximate rato of <span>rural outlets to urban outlets would be:

5000  :  17000

5 : 17

1 : 3.4       

Since it's just asking for approximate, we can round the ratio down into

1 : 3

1. In the case below, the original source material is given along with a sample of student work. Determine the type of plagiaris
Julli [10]

Answer:

This is not plagiarism

Explanation:

In research, the term plagiarism refers to the fact of taking someone else's ideas or concepts and use them as if they were one's own. In other words, when writing a paper, we use someone else's work and we don't quote the original authors and it seems as if the words were ours.

In this example, <u>the student quoted the original author of the paper and used one of his quotes in his work but he did give the author credit and he didn't make it seem as if the words were the student's own words. </u>Therefore, this doesn't classify as plagiarism.
